Technical Overview and Functional Advantages
Embossed carrier tape is manufactured through a thermoforming or blistering process, where plastic materials are molded into continuous tapes with precisely shaped pockets. These pockets securely hold electronic components during storage and transportation. The design ensures:
- Mechanical protection against vibration and physical damage
- Electrostatic discharge (ESD) protection for sensitive semiconductor devices
- Alignment precision for automated pick-and-place systems
From a technical perspective, the dimensional accuracy of pocket formation is critical, especially for high-density integrated circuits and miniaturized components. Material Segmentation and Product Innovation
The Embossed Carrier Tape market is segmented by material type, with the following key categories:
- Polycarbonate (PC)
- Polystyrene (PS)
- Polyethylene Terephthalate (PET)
- Polypropylene (PP)
- Polyvinyl Chloride (PVC)
- Others
Among these, polycarbonate and polystyrene dominate, collectively accounting for approximately 80% of total market share. These materials are favored due to their:
- उत्कृष्ट dimensional stability
- High impact resistance
- Superior transparency for optical inspection
Recent innovation trends include the development of anti-static and conductive materials, which enhance ESD protection solutions and improve reliability in high-speed manufacturing environments.
Application Analysis and Industry Use Cases
The application landscape of Embossed Carrier Tape is diverse, with the following key segments:
- Power Discrete Devices (40% market share)
- Integrated Circuits (ICs)
- Optoelectronics
- Others
Power discrete devices represent the largest segment due to their widespread use in automotive electronics, industrial power systems, and renewable energy applications.
Case Study: A semiconductor manufacturer in Southeast Asia recently implemented advanced embossed carrier tape solutions for packaging power MOSFET devices. By switching to high-precision polycarbonate tapes with improved pocket uniformity, the company reduced component misalignment during automated assembly by 30%, significantly improving production yield.
Integrated circuits and optoelectronics segments are also experiencing rapid growth, driven by 5G infrastructure, AI chips, and advanced display technologies.
Competitive Landscape and Market Share
The global market is moderately consolidated, with the top five manufacturers—3M, Advantek, Shin-Etsu, ZheJiang Jiemei, and C-Pak—collectively accounting for approximately 50% of total market share.
Other significant players include:
- Lasertek
- U-PAK
- ROTHE
- Tek Pak
- Asahi Kasei
- ACTECH
- Ant Group (Acupaq)
- Advanced Component Taping
- Hwa Shu Enterprise
Competition is primarily driven by:
- Material innovation and customization capabilities
- Precision manufacturing and quality consistency
- Global supply chain integration
- Cost competitiveness in high-volume production
